Passport photos at Jim Owen Studio in Mobile, 36618

Are you searching for a passport photo place in Mobile? Jim Owen Studio offers passport photo services.

Address
1901 W I-65 Service Rd N, Mobile, AL 36618, United States

Phone number
1 251-476-1514